ASP(Active Server Pages)是一种用于创建动态网页的技术,而Cookie是存储在用户浏览器中的小型数据文件。通过ASP,开发者可以轻松地读取和写入Cookie,从而实现个性化用户体验。
写入Cookie的基本方法是使用Response对象的Cookies集合。例如,可以通过以下代码设置一个名为“username”的Cookie,并将其值设为“John”:
Response.Cookies(\"username\") = \"John\"
为了确保Cookie能够正确保存,还可以设置其过期时间。默认情况下,Cookie会在浏览器关闭时被删除。如果希望Cookie长期有效,可以使用Expires属性:
AI绘图结果,仅供参考
Response.Cookies(\"username\").Expires = DateAdd(\"d\", 7, Now())
读取Cookie则使用Request对象的Cookies集合。例如,获取之前设置的“username”Cookie的值:
Dim user
在实际应用中,需要注意Cookie的安全性和隐私问题。不应在Cookie中存储敏感信息,如密码或信用卡号。•应检查Cookie是否存在,以避免程序出错。
ASP还支持对Cookie进行更复杂的操作,比如设置路径、域名和安全标志。这些选项可以增强Cookie的功能和安全性,适用于更高级的应用场景。